Output 142b8d9536baa16a8a067eca875972a1a376b82c7502c1a8278ef224d6551ef5:0

value
40000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d844aa5a1e230d85b7a7bb7582ccbbcb2e63606 OP_EQUALVERIFY OP_CHECKSIG
address
19XUKd2AHLRTJnco8WU7Rv9hfgt8hcQnZG
transaction
142b8d9536baa16a8a067eca875972a1a376b82c7502c1a8278ef224d6551ef5
confirmations
501113
spent
true